Core Components of Total Energy Expenditure (TEE)
Total Energy Expenditure is the total amount of energy your body uses over a 24-hour period. It is composed of three main areas:
1. Resting Metabolic Rate (RMR) / Resting Energy Expenditure (REE)
This is the energy your body needs to maintain basic functions while at rest, such as breathing, circulation, brain function, and cell production. It accounts for the largest portion of TEE for most people. Factors influencing RMR/REE include age, sex, body size, muscle mass, genetics, and hormonal status.
2. Thermic Effect of Food (TEF) / Diet-Induced Thermogenesis (DIT)
TEF, also known as DIT, is the energy required by your body to digest, absorb, transport, and store the nutrients from the food you eat. This process uses energy, and the amount varies depending on the type of macronutrient consumed (protein has the highest TEF, followed by carbohydrates, then fats).
3. Physical Activity
This component includes the energy spent on all forms of movement, from structured exercise like running or weightlifting to non-exercise activity thermogenesis (NEAT), which includes activities like walking, standing, fidgeting, and performing daily tasks. This is often the most variable component of TEE and can range significantly based on a person's lifestyle and activity level.
In summary, TEE is the sum of these three factors:
Component | Description | Contribution to TEE (Approximate) |
---|---|---|
Resting Metabolic Rate (RMR) | Energy for basic bodily functions at rest | 60-75% |
Thermic Effect of Food (TEF) | Energy for digestion, absorption, and storage of nutrients | 10% |
Physical Activity | Energy spent on all forms of movement and exercise | 15-30% (Highly Variable) |
